Was going through my backlog and noticed this. Standard "Pixel Puzzle" format with ts the placing pieces with a particular orientation and location variety; no placing pieces together off the board. Has a major flaw: there is an annoying fairy that gabbers constantly. Now you can turn it off by clicking delete key inside a puzzle - however that also turns off the hint parts as well. You can also set the the master volume to 0; but then you don't get the click audible feedback when you correctly place a puzzle piece which does make a difference at the higher levels. Buy the modern pixel puzzle games instead: such as "ultimate" or "illustrations & anime." Wish there was a "meh" because I was able to complete it but the fairy reduced the ease of use significantly for me.
